The Department of School Education, Government of Andhra Pradesh, has released the AP TET 2025 admit cards. Candidates appearing for the Andhra Pradesh Teacher Eligibility Test can now download their hall tickets from the official website, tet2dsc.apcfss.in, using their candidate ID and date of birth.
As per the schedule, the AP TET 2025 exam will begin on December 10 in computer-based test (CBT) mode and will be held in two shifts each day. Candidates must carry a printed copy of the admit card along with a valid photo ID to the exam centre.
After downloading, candidates should check all details on the admit card carefully. Any errors must be immediately reported to the authorities for correction.
AP TET Admit Card 2025: How to download
Here’s a step by step guide to access your AP TET hall ticket:
Step 1: Visit the official website — tet2dsc.apcfss.in
Step 2: Log in using your candidate ID, mobile number or Aadhaar number, and date of birth
Step 3: Click on “Submit” to view the hall ticket
Step 4: Download the admit card and take a clear printout for exam day
Once downloaded, candidates appearing for AP TET 2025 can check to verify the exam name, allotted exam-centre, and guidelines that candidates are required to follow on the day of the examination.

The AP TET, conducted annually by the Department of School Education, Andhra Pradesh, determines eligibility for teaching posts in primary and upper primary schools across the state.
Candidates who qualify Paper I become eligible to teach Classes 1–5, while those clearing Paper II may teach Classes 6–8. Those who clear both papers become eligible for teaching positions from Classes 1–8 in government schools across Andhra Pradesh.
